so I found out about Ionic around two weeks ago and I decided to try to make a simple Android app with it. The main thing is, that I can't even get it to get installed correctly.
The main problem is the following:
$ node -v
v4.2.3
$ cordova -v
5.4.1
$ ionic info
Your system information:
Cordova CLI: Not installed
Ionic CLI Version: 1.7.12
Ionic App Lib Version: 0.6.5
OS:
Node Version: v4.2.3
******************************************************
Dependency warning - for the CLI to run correctly, it is highly suggested to install/upgrade the following:
Please install your Cordova CLI to version >=4.2.0 `npm install -g cordova`
******************************************************
I've tried multiple approaches and various tutorials because I thought I'm too dumb to get it installed. I tried reinstalling, clearing npm cache and various Cordova version several times but nothing has changed. The weird thing is, Cordova in itself works and I can create projects, but ionic just does not recognize the Cordova CLI, which causes several plugin errors if I want to create a project with ionic.
